I bought mine used last year and it's always done this in a cold start. But its very mild. Feels like the engine is misfiring a bit. Then about 20 seconds later I hear a 3 second whining sound from the engine. When that stops the engine no longer shakes. I've just assumed this was normal as the car was warming up.
